ABOUT PFLAG LOS ANGELES
Who Are We?
PFLAG Los Angeles is dedicated to creating a caring, just, and affirming world for LGBTQ+ people and those who love them. Our work focuses on three pillars: education, advocacy, and support. We invite you to join us in building a safer, more inclusive world for all. Learn more at www.pflagla.org.

ABOUT THE POSITION
Role: Operations Co-Chair (Board Member)
Responsibilities
- Manage and update our website, as needed.
- Maintain our tech stack, including permissions and troubleshooting.
- Recruiting tasks, such as conduct screening interviews for new volunteers or board members.
- Other operational tasks as needed; all responsibilities are shared between both co-chairs.
- Co-create/deliver trainings (e.g., cybersecurity, new tools) to board members and volunteers.
Qualifications
- Reliable access to computer and webcam.
- Strong organizational and collaboration skills.
- Strong knowledge of software and digital technology.
- Experience with Google Admin and Monday.com preferred, but not required.
